The opportunity
UAL Awarding Body is seeking a skilled Senior Qualifications Development Officer to lead the design and development of innovative qualifications for 14-19 and 19 + learners. This is an exciting opportunity to shape the future of creative education at a world leading arts university, ensuring every qualification meets the highest standards of quality.
This post is based in UAL Awarding Body, part of the University of the Arts London. We design, develop and award creative arts qualifications that empower and inspire educators to help students reach their potential. UAL Awarding Body is regulated by Ofqual, Qualifications Wales and CCEA Regulations at Entry Level 3 to 5 of the national qualification framework. We work with approved centres to offer qualifications in Art and Design, Fashion Business and Retail, Creative Media Production and Technology, Music Performance and Production and Performing and Production Arts, and Project qualifications. UAL Awarding Body has a pipeline of new qualifications in development for 14-19-and 19+ year-olds, and a qualification development and review cycle that needs to be undertaken to meet regulatory requirements and exploit commercial opportunities.
As Senior Qualifications Development Officer, you will be responsible for managing and undertaking qualification development activities, ensuring all projects are delivered on time, within budget and to the highest standard. This includes paying close attention to technical content, regulatory compliance and the overall quality of our qualifications.
Working closely with both internal and external stakeholders, you will gather and interpret evidence that supports qualification design and development activities. Additionally, you will review existing qualifications and resources, making recommendations for amendments or withdrawal where necessary. You will also help define, develop and implement new qualification specifications, policies and procedures, playing a key role in ensuring ongoing qualification compliance with Regulators’ Conditions of Recognition.
About you
We are looking for an individual who is capable of managing multiple projects simultaneously and prioritising their own workload effectively. You will have experience in qualification and assessment design, with a solid understanding of the full development and design cycle.
Excellent project management skills are essential, including experience of leading concurrent projects, pairing this with a thorough understanding of the further/higher education sectors and the creative industries. Strong organisational, planning and communication skills are also required, along with the ability to convey complex information clearly and inclusively to a diverse audience.
To be considered for this role, a satisfactory Basic DBS check is required in addition to our standard pre-employment checks.
